polyurethane foam products are a versatile and innovative solution used across a wide range of industries for numerous applications. This synthetic material is created through a chemical reaction between polyols and diisocyanates, resulting in a material with a cellular structure that can be tailored to meet specific needs. From insulation and cushioning to packaging and automotive components, polyurethane foam products offer a multitude of benefits that make them an essential part of modern manufacturing processes.

One of the most common uses of polyurethane foam products is in insulation. Polyurethane foam is an excellent insulator due to its closed-cell structure, which traps air and prevents heat from escaping. This makes it an ideal material for insulating buildings, refrigerators, and vehicles, helping to reduce energy costs and improve energy efficiency. In addition to its insulating properties, polyurethane foam can also help to reduce noise and vibration, making it a popular choice for soundproofing applications.

In the automotive industry, polyurethane foam products are used for a wide range of applications. From seat cushions and headrests to dashboard components and insulation, polyurethane foam plays a crucial role in enhancing the comfort, safety, and performance of vehicles. Polyurethane foam is lightweight and easy to mold, making it an ideal material for reducing weight and improving fuel efficiency in cars and trucks. Additionally, polyurethane foam can help to absorb impact energy in the event of a collision, providing added protection for passengers.
